  6. Founded on October 16, 1923, by brothers Walt Disney and Roy O. Disney, [1] it is the oldest-running animation studio in the world. It is currently organized as a division of Walt Disney Studios and is headquartered at the Roy E. Disney Animation Building at the Walt Disney Studios lot in Burbank, California. [7]

  7. Cel animation is one of the most traditional forms of animation and involves objects - usually characters - being hand-drawn on clear celluloid sheets and placed over painted backgrounds. These are known as animated cels or animation cels. Artists at Walt Disney Studios popularised the technique from the 1930s.
